Sample Answer
The distinction between a celebrity and a hero lies fundamentally in the nature and impact of their public personas. A celebrity often garners fame predominantly through entertainment, sports, or social media presence, typically as a result of their talent or mere visibility. Their significance may largely revolve around their appearance and lifestyle, which tends to evoke admiration or envy, but not necessarily profound respect.
Conversely, a hero is characterized by their actions that demonstrate exceptional courage, altruism, or moral integrity. Heroes often engage in selfless endeavors aimed at the betterment of society, risking personal comfort or safety for the welfare of others. Thus, while both may achieve public recognition, the hero's legacy is rooted in their contributions to humanity, often inspiring others to act with similar nobility.
